Dear friends in Open Space
I am putting a topic on the wall for this coming Thursday Open Space Garden, the second timeslot. 17.00 (CEST).

Topic name: Open Space for protecting and strengthening the democracy.

Background: Since 2023 I have been part of organizing Open Spaces around this topic. One in September 2023 and one in April 2024. Both were 3-day conferences starting with storytelling evening one, a full day of Open Space and then half a day for actionplanning and closing.
Many actions have happened and are happening since then, including a few more open spaces both regional ones and inside organizations.

My question is if our example can inspire others to do similar or other activities? Also we still need to find ways to make it more sustainable regarding financing all the work we put into this.

I will share a bit from our work by showing the QiqoChat Space that Lucas has provided for us. We use it to gather the most important info in one space including what is happening after the conferences with action teams etc.

How it Works
The "gardens" are always open.  You can even try it now.  It is a simple webpage with a picture of a garden and a "Join Video" button.  Click the button to open Zoom.

Yes, you can drop in any day and at any time, but to make it more likely that you will find someone to talk to when you are there, we're starting with two gathering times every Thursday.  Those times are shown above.

On the left side of the page, you'll see a list of gardens in different countries.  You can move to any of these gardens and join Zoom when you get there.  To let others know what you are discussing on Zoom, click the pencil and type in the topic.  People in the other gardens will see the topic change and if they are interested in it, they can bumble bee over to join you.

Dear Funda,

not many academics have ever been in touch with a three day os event.
Even folks facilitating os events have not been at a three day event.

There are loads of facilitators working for participation.
As an open space facilitator I have never worked for participation.
My focus has always  been on increasing time and space for the unfolding of
the force of selforganisation... and trying to be invisible and fully
present at
the same time.
Its amazing how many and perhaps all conditions folks admire rise up and
naturally show
themselves in os events: laughter, excitement, passion, learning,
working together,
unprecedented results, shared leadership/management/vision building/,
listening, effectiveness, brother- and sisterhood, enjoying conflict,  
etc.
None of these were the business of the facilitator.

Now, academics, as everyone else, would be amazed. They experienced
nothing like it
in their life and work. But they do not express themselves primarily
about how amazing
they are, its natural for them, to selforganize, its just a rare
condition that is available just
a little bit more than in every day life.

Thank you Thomas, Peggy, Funda and Michael for this contribution!

At Open Facilitation Ireland, participation and democracy is exactly what we are aiming for! In Ireland, we are close to our politicians in that we know where they lived, can get face time with them etc but our democratic deficit is in the consultation processes. The whole systems lacks the capacity to gather input from the bottom up, even though many structures are formally in place. So we are trying to convince them to lets us help!  I don't think any of us will make the call tomorrow as we are "participating" elsewhere 😉 but we will look forward to reading about the outcomes and would love to be involved in these discussions in future!

A propos Academics, we have had some fun introducing the OS concept to academics - It turns their world of top-down education upside down! We will keep trying!

Thanks for all reactions
Just want to let you know that my sponsor/collegue/friend Kinna Skoglund will join on Thursday too. She is a well-known grassroot activist in Sweden who believes in and loves Open Space. So we teamed up – her being “the face outward” attracting people from all walks of life – and me supporting with facilitation in preps, the OST-meetings and follow-ups.
I will prepare a little design for our session, with Whole Person Process Facilitation, WPPF as a container. My plan is that we’ll start by landing together in the circle, then Kinna and I will share a bit more about our initiative incl the opportunities and issues we see. Space for questions and reflections and a closing circle. Maybe an hour will be good for our session – with possible “offsprings”.
